NOVANEWS JONATHAN COOK Washington Report on Middle East Affairs, January/February 2019, pp. 30-32 The Nakba Continues By Jonathan Cook IDO EVEN-PAZ SWITCHED ON his body camera as his tour group decamped from the bus in Hebron. The former Israeli soldier wanted to document any trouble we might encounter in this, the largest Palestinian city in the occupied West Bank. It was not Hebron’s Palestinian residents who concerned him, however. He was worried about fellow Israelis—Jewish religious extremists and the soldiers there to guard them—who have seized control of much of the city center. Even-Paz, 34, first served as a soldier in Hebron in the early 2000s.
